Argentina road safety incidents July 2026

The string of serious accidents that began with fatal collisions on Ruta 7 (July 10), Ruta 11 (July 11) and the head‑on crash on Ruta Provincial 88 (July 15) continued through the month. On July 16 a Vía TAC bus lost stability while crossing a bridge on National Route 7 near Carmen de Areco during a severe windstorm, falling several metres and injuring 19 passengers, including a baby, but causing no deaths. July 17 saw a front‑end collision on Route 4 near La Carlota, Córdoba, killing both occupants of a Citroën Berlingo while the truck driver escaped with minor injuries. July 18 brought a Tu Bus in Buenos Aires into a house after the driver suffered a medical episode, and a separate bus‑collision in Pachuca, Mexico injured four passengers. A broader report added several Argentine incidents: a 35‑year‑old pedestrian was killed by a high‑performance motorcycle in Puerto Iguazú; a young motorcyclist in Concordia was seriously injured after colliding with a Volkswagen Gol while riding without lights or a helmet; a car in General Roca was rear‑ended and driven away; a municipal crane’s illegal U‑turn in Mar del Plata crashed into a family’s RAM van, injuring three municipal officers; a vehicle struck a fuel pump on Route 12 near Empedrado; and a crash on Route 22 near Plaza Huincul left a woman with a skull fracture. On July 21 a severe collision on the Autovía Gervasio Artigas (Route 14) involved a Renault Alaskan van and a Mercedes Benz truck, killing a 13‑year‑old girl and a 49‑year‑old woman. The van driver and a 14‑year‑old passenger were seriously injured; emergency crews from several fire brigades, police and medical services rescued the trapped occupants and transported the injured to hospitals.
